Decoding the Numbers: Curb Weight vs. GVWR

When discussing the 2022 Chevy Silverado weight, it is crucial to distinguish between curb weight and gross vehicle weight rating (GVWR). Curb weight refers to the truck's weight with a full tank of gas and all standard equipment, but without any passengers or cargo. GVWR, on the other hand, is the maximum total weight of the loaded vehicle, including the curb weight, passengers, and everything inside the cabin and truck bed. Exceeding the GVWR can compromise safety, handling, and warranty compliance.

Variations Across Trim Levels and Cab Styles

The Silverado's weight varies significantly depending on the trim level and body configuration. A standard cab short box will be considerably lighter than a double cab with an extended box due to the additional materials and structural reinforcements required. Furthermore, the transition to an aluminum hood and tailgate in the 2022 model year was a significant step toward reducing the overall weight compared to its steel predecessors, improving fuel efficiency and payload capacity.

The Impact of the Multi-Function Tailgate

One of the standout features of the 2022 Silverado is its available multi-function tailgate, which offers several operational modes, including a side-swing function. While this technology adds convenience, it also contributes to the overall mass of the truck. Engineers had to balance the functionality of the tailgate with the need to keep the payload capacity competitive, ensuring the weight did not negate the benefits of the aluminum body components.

Payload and Towing Capacity Considerations

Heavier truck configurations often correlate with higher towing capacities, but the relationship is not always linear. The 2022 Chevy Silverado leverages its robust frame and available powertrains to achieve impressive towing figures that can exceed 10,000 pounds. However, the actual safe towing capacity for your specific truck depends entirely on the axle ratio, suspension setup, and whether the optional tow package is installed, as these factors determine how the weight is distributed and managed under stress.

Knowing the exact specifications of your 2022 Chevy Silverado weight allows you to make informed decisions about modifications. Installing larger tires, adding a bed liner, or equipping a heavy-duty hitch all impact the total weight. Staying informed about these numbers ensures your vehicle remains within safe operating parameters for daily driving and long-distance hauling.
